Hyundai Starts a National "Always Around" Campaign with Free Service Benefits and Accessories

Hyundai Motor India has launched its brand-new ‘Always Around’ campaign, a one-day statewide event aimed at providing a number of worthwhile advantages to both new and current vehicle owners. Free accessories worth ₹10,000 are given away with new reservations, along with free car inspections, reduced prices on services, and chances for test drives and exchange assessments. Hyundai wants to deepen its relationship with consumers and provide a more convenient, fulfilling car-ownership experience throughout India by fusing sales assistance with after-sales service.

  • Hyundai's "Always Around" national campaign, which combines customer service, sales, and exchange incentives, was introduced on February 8, 2026.

  • While current owners can take advantage of a number of free services and discounts, new customers can receive ₹10,000 worth of accessories for free when they book on the spot.

The Always Around campaign was introduced by Hyundai Motor India Limited on Sunday, February 8, 2026, in dealerships and other specific sites throughout the nation to provide customers with a combination of sales, support, and service advantages.

The program, which is planned as a one-day national event, is to facilitate the process of examining Hyundai automobiles, participating in guided test drives, and interacting with service professionals in a single location.

Huge Benefits for First-Time Buyers

During the promotion, Hyundai is offering complimentary accessories valued at ₹10,000 to potential customers who decide to reserve a Hyundai vehicle right away. Genuine Hyundai accessories that improve comfort and style can be among them. An immediate advantage like this adds real value and tries to promote reservations on the day of the event.

Without having to make the typical dispersed dealership trips, clients can compare models, take test drives, and look at options all in one visit.

Exclusive Benefits for Current Owners

On that day, current Hyundai owners were also given excellent treatment. At the Always Around event, attendees may take advantage of a number of free and reduced services aimed at enhancing vehicle maintenance.

A complimentary car wash, a 25-point vehicle inspection, and substantial savings on services, including 50% off wheel alignment, 30% off interior cleaning, and 20% off labour and original accessories, were among them.

Customers could also have the worth of their car evaluated for exchange in addition to these offers, which would make it simpler for them to choose a newer model if they wanted to upgrade.
